Konwerter TSV na YAML
Konwertuj TSV (Tab-Separated Values) na format YAML
Dane Wejściowe TSV
Szukasz szybkiego i niezawodnego Konwertera TSV na YAML? Trafiłeś we właściwe miejsce. Konwertowanie plików Tab-Separated Values (TSV) do formatu YAML nie musi być skomplikowane. Niezależnie od tego, czy jesteś programistą pracującym z plikami konfiguracyjnymi, analitykiem danych restrukturyzującym zestawy danych, czy kimkolwiek zajmującym się transformacją danych, nasz Konwerter TSV na YAML sprawia, że proces jest płynny i prosty. Po prostu wgraj swój plik TSV i otrzymaj czysty, prawidłowo sformatowany YAML w kilka sekund.
Czym jest Konwerter TSV na YAML?
Konwerter TSV na YAML to specjalistyczne narzędzie, które przekształca dane tabelaryczne zapisane w formacie TSV do formatu YAML (YAML Ain't Markup Language). Pliki TSV używają tabulatorów do oddzielania kolumn danych, co czyni je popularnymi przy eksporcie arkuszy kalkulacyjnych i zrzutach baz danych. YAML z kolei to czytelny dla człowieka format serializacji danych, szeroko stosowany w plikach konfiguracyjnych, wymianie danych między aplikacjami oraz przechowywaniu ustrukturyzowanych informacji w przejrzysty, hierarchiczny sposób.
Proces konwersji bierze twoje wiersze i kolumny rozdzielone tabulatorami i restrukturyzuje je w zagnieżdżone pary klucz-wartość lub struktury list w formacie YAML. Ta transformacja jest niezbędna, gdy musisz przenieść dane z aplikacji arkuszowych do nowoczesnych środowisk deweloperskich, systemów zarządzania konfiguracją lub aplikacji, które konsumują pliki YAML.
Dlaczego warto używać Konwertera TSV na YAML?
Konwertowanie plików TSV do formatu YAML oferuje kilka praktycznych korzyści dla programistów i specjalistów od danych:
- Zarządzanie konfiguracją: YAML to format z wyboru dla Docker Compose, Kubernetes, Ansible i wielu pipeline'ów CI/CD. Konwersja danych TSV pomaga szybko generować pliki konfiguracyjne z danych arkuszowych.
- Lepsza czytelność: Struktura YAML oparta na wcięciach jest znacznie bardziej czytelna dla człowieka niż wartości rozdzielone tabulatorami, co ułatwia przeglądanie i edycję złożonych struktur danych.
- Integracja danych: Wiele nowoczesnych API i aplikacji akceptuje dane wejściowe w formacie YAML. Konwersja z TSV pozwala połączyć starsze formaty danych z nowoczesnymi systemami.
- Przyjazne dla kontroli wersji: Pliki YAML działają lepiej z Git i innymi systemami kontroli wersji w porównaniu do binarnych formatów arkuszy, co ułatwia współpracę.
- Hierarchiczna reprezentacja danych: YAML naturalnie wspiera zagnieżdżone struktury, pozwalając reprezentować złożone relacje, które trudno wyrazić w płaskich plikach TSV.
Jak działa Konwerter TSV na YAML?
Nasz konwerter usprawnia proces transformacji poprzez inteligentne parsowanie i formatowanie. Narzędzie odczytuje twój plik TSV linia po linii, identyfikuje separatory tabulatorów i odpowiednio mapuje strukturę danych. Pierwszy wiersz zazwyczaj staje się kluczami w strukturze YAML, podczas gdy kolejne wiersze stają się wartościami lub elementami listy w zależności od organizacji twoich danych.
Kluczowe funkcje naszego Konwertera TSV na YAML
- Automatyczne wykrywanie schematu: Konwerter inteligentnie rozpoznaje nagłówki i typy danych, aby utworzyć prawidłowo ustrukturyzowany wynik YAML.
- Zachowuje integralność danych: Znaki specjalne, cudzysłowy i formatowanie są obsługiwane poprawnie, aby zapewnić brak utraty danych podczas konwersji.
- Natychmiastowe przetwarzanie: Konwertuj pliki w kilka sekund bez skomplikowanej konfiguracji lub instalacji oprogramowania.
- Czysty wynik: Wygenerowany YAML przestrzega odpowiednich standardów wcięć i formatowania, gotowy do użycia w twoich projektach.
Typowe zastosowania konwersji TSV na YAML
Programiści i specjaliści od danych używają naszego Konwertera TSV na YAML w różnych scenariuszach:
- Generowanie ConfigMaps dla Kubernetes z danych arkuszowych
- Tworzenie plików inventory dla Ansible z wyeksportowanych list serwerów
- Konwertowanie wyników zapytań bazodanowych na pliki konfiguracyjne aplikacji
- Przekształcanie eksportów CSV/TSV do YAML dla generatorów stron statycznych jak Jekyll czy Hugo
- Przygotowywanie danych testowych dla frameworków automatycznego testowania
Kiedy powinieneś konwertować TSV na YAML?
Rozważ użycie Konwertera TSV na YAML zawsze, gdy pracujesz z danymi tabelarycznymi, które muszą się zintegrować z nowoczesnymi workflow'ami deweloperskimi. Jeśli utrzymujesz pliki konfiguracyjne, konfigurujesz infrastructure as code lub budujesz pipeline'y danych, które konsumują YAML, konwersja plików TSV staje się niezbędna. Jest to szczególnie przydatne przy współpracy z zespołami, które preferują czytelność YAML lub gdy twoje narzędzia wdrożeniowe wymagają konkretnie formatu YAML.
Gotowy do transformacji swoich danych? Nasz Konwerter TSV na YAML zajmuje się technicznymi szczegółami, abyś mógł skupić się na tym, co ważne - budowaniu świetnych aplikacji i efektywnym zarządzaniu danymi. Niezależnie od tego, czy konwertujesz mały plik konfiguracyjny, czy przetwarzasz większe zestawy danych, za każdym razem otrzymasz dokładny, dobrze sformatowany wynik YAML.